Sump Pump Plumbing in Boston, MA
Sump pump plumbing services involve installing, repairing, or replacing sump pumps to help protect homes from flooding and water damage. These systems are typically installed in basements or crawl spaces to automatically remove excess groundwater or rainwater that accumulates around the foundation. Projects may include upgrading an existing sump pump, fixing issues with water discharge, or installing a new sump pump system to ensure reliable operation during heavy storms or periods of high groundwater levels. Homeowners often want to understand the capacity of the sump pump, how it integrates with drainage systems, and what maintenance is needed to keep it functioning properly.
Before requesting sump pump plumbing services, property owners should consider the size and layout of their property, the frequency of flooding or water intrusion, and any existing drainage or sump pump systems. It’s helpful to assess whether the current system is adequate for the property’s needs or if upgrades are necessary. Additionally, understanding the type of sump pump best suited for the property’s conditions-such as pedestal or submersible models-can influence the project scope. Clear information about these factors can help ensure the installation or repair meets the specific requirements of the home or building.

Sump Pump Plumbing Questions
What is a sump pump? A sump pump is a device installed in a basement or crawl space to remove accumulated water and prevent flooding.
How do I know if my sump pump needs repairs? Signs include frequent cycling, strange noises, or water not draining properly from the sump pit.
What causes sump pump failures? Common causes are power outages, clogged discharge lines, or worn-out float switches.
When should a sump pump be replaced? Replacement is recommended if the pump frequently fails, shows signs of rust, or is over 10 years old.
